This is a stunning sculptural, European bronze and marble clock from the mid 19th Century. It has a hand wound mechanical mechanism. I have not tried to wind it as I do not have the right key. Most of these clocks ever need is just to be taken apart and have the old grease cleaned up on them. This one might work though I just have not tested it. I’m selling a more of a figural sculptural piece as it is very gorgeous. Has a statue of a man most likely, a hunter and his dog with a bird in his hand. There’s also a small piece that I think hung around the man, but I’m not sure if it originally went with his clock. The dial is made out of porcelain. There are no makers marks on it that I can find. The fennel piece at the top of the clock you can spin. And the man wobbles a tiny bit. The bolts holding them into place can probably be tightened again. I did not mess with them.
